Geniotek provides on-demand Fractional CTO services for hardware startups. They offer concept feasibility audits, industrial design, and transparent manufacturing support. The agency helps bring physical products from concept to mass production faster.

THE CABINET is a Hong Kong-based branding design studio founded in 2005 by award-winning designer Malou. The studio has completed over 150 projects for more than 100 clients including Standard Chartered, Cathay Pacific, and Ralph Lauren.
